Academic Program Coordinator, Trent-in-Ecuador – new deadline
The Department of International Development Studies at Trent University
invites applications for a nine-month position as Academic Coordinator
of the Trent-in-Ecuador (TIE) Program located in Quito, Ecuador.
The Academic Coordinator works with a locally based Administrative
Coordinator to deliver a comprehensive academic program for
approximately 20 students from Trent and other Canadian
universities. Teaching responsibilities include a third-year
undergraduate-level course on “Andean Economy, Culture and Society”;
teaching and supervising students in a double-credit course in
“Community Development” (which involves student work placements for 10
weeks in the winter term). Other responsibilities include coordinating
3 other courses taught by local academics and advising students.
Qualifications: social science expertise in Latin American studies,
preferably in the Andean region; PhD (awarded or near completion),
ability to work in English and Spanish.
Term of appointment: August 15th, 2011 to May 15th, 2012, with the
possibility of renewal.
Salary: CAD 34200.00 plus some professional expenses.
New Deadline: April 29, 2011
